home *** CD-ROM | disk | FTP | other *** search
/ Amiga MA Magazine 1998 #6 / amigamamagazinepolishissue1998.iso / varia / getscreenid_1.1 / gsi.doc < prev    next >
Text File  |  1980-01-10  |  6KB  |  180 lines

  1.           #############################################################
  2.  
  3.                                  GetScreenID 1.1
  4.  
  5.                          Written by GONCALVES A. Georges
  6.  
  7.                Copyright © 1994 by GONCALVES A. Georges ( Melkor )
  8.                                All rights reserved
  9.  
  10.           #############################################################
  11.  
  12.  
  13.  
  14.                                    User manual
  15.  
  16.                                        of
  17.  
  18.                                    GetScreenID
  19.                                    version 1.1
  20.  
  21.  
  22.                                    * Sommary *
  23.  
  24.  
  25.                         1 - Disclaimer
  26.                         2 - Distribution
  27.                         3 - Introduction
  28.                         4 - Requirements
  29.                         5 - Usage
  30.                         6 - Hints and Tips
  31.                         7 - Acknowledgements
  32.                         8 - Contacting author
  33.  
  34.  
  35.   1 - Disclaimer :
  36.   ----------------
  37.  
  38.   The author is not responsible for any damage caused directly  or  indirectly
  39.   by  the  use  of this program. If your monitor explode, your hardisk crashed
  40.   and no more formatable or your 680x0 changed in an Intel type processor  its
  41.   not my fault. Use it at your own risk.
  42.  
  43.  
  44.   2 - Distribution :
  45.   ------------------
  46.  
  47.   You can distribute it as long as you don't make money with it :(  It's NOT
  48.   public domain but freely distribuable. Really, it's a CardWare program. That
  49.   means if you enjoy and use it, you have the moral obligation to send me a
  50.   postal card of your city or country, not so expensive I think ;-)
  51.  
  52.  
  53.   3 - Introduction :
  54.   ------------------
  55.  
  56.   Have you never been annoyed when you want to display a  picture,  with  your
  57.   favourite  viewer,  in  a different screenmode than the one specified in the
  58.   picture file and your viewer asks for a display ID or the string name of the
  59.   screenmode instead of opening a ScreenModeRequester like the Asl or Reqtools
  60.   ones ? Sure yes ! Don't you think that is very boring to type something like
  61.   "PAL:High  Res  no  flicker"  every  time  you  want  it.  This  string only
  62.   represents the DisplayID  of  a  ScreenMode  and  its  better  to  choose  a
  63.   ScreenMode in a requester, isn't it ? That's the job of GetScreenID. It
  64.   works similary to those GetPubName programs.
  65.  
  66.  
  67.   4 - Requirements :
  68.   ------------------
  69.  
  70.   You must have some little things in order to get GSI to work :
  71.  
  72.     - Reqtools.library V38 or better
  73.     
  74.     - a little Shell knowledge ( very little )
  75.     
  76.     - an Amiga ( GSI is useless on PCs as Screens don't exists ;-> )
  77.  
  78.     - You must hate MicroSoft Windows ;-)
  79.  
  80.  
  81.   5 - Usage :
  82.   -----------
  83.  
  84.   Here is the HARDER part ( joke ! )
  85.  
  86.   From Workbench : Doubleclick it and you'll have a ScreenModeRequester.
  87.                    Choose the Mode and a Requester will show you the
  88.                    appropriate DisplayID. Workbench use is most for info
  89.                    purpose.
  90.  
  91.   From Shell     : Type GSI and you'll get the ScreenModeRequester. When
  92.                    selected the DisplayID is inserted in the command line
  93.                    so you can use it as follows :
  94.  
  95.                    PicViewer Pics:BeautyfullGirl SCREENMODE=`GSI`
  96.  
  97.                    and your PicViewer will receive as argument :
  98.  
  99.                    PicViewer Pics:BeautyfullGirl SCREENMODE=A9004
  100.  
  101.                    for "PAL:High Res No Flicker".
  102.  
  103.  
  104.   Can it be easier ?
  105.  
  106.  
  107.   6 - Hints ans tips :
  108.   --------------------
  109.  
  110.   GSI has some features that can be transparent for a normal user and usefull
  111.   for experienced ones.
  112.  
  113.   o The requesters appear on the frontmost public screen.
  114.  
  115.   o if the program that requires the DisplayID wants a 'C' formated hex number
  116.     just add the 'C' prefix for a hex number : 0x or 0X
  117.  
  118.     ex:  PicViewer Pics:BeautyfullGirl SCREENMODE=0x`GSI` or ...MODE=0X`GSI`
  119.  
  120.     to   PicViewer Pics:BeautifullGirl SCREENMODE=0xA9004 or ...MODE=0XA9004
  121.  
  122.  
  123.   7 - Acknowledgements :
  124.   ----------------------
  125.  
  126.   GSI has been created using SAS/C 6.51 ( Poor guys on PCs with Borland  C  :-)
  127.   It  was linked with the TinyStartup lib © Stéphane BUNEL ( TinyStartup is the
  128.   MUI of startups, it controls all for you and so simple to use ( even  a  BABY
  129.   can  program  with  it  ! ). Edition by GoldED ( Only Dietmar Eilert makes it
  130.   possible ) on OS 3.x Kickstart 40.68, Workbench 40.42 ( What a wonderfull  OS
  131.   ! ). Documentation was a piece of cake with the ( buggy but cool ) AGWritter.
  132.   Of course, only an Amiga can run this thingies ( Thanks to the engineers  for
  133.   making a so wonderfull computer ).
  134.  
  135.   and now the friends...
  136.  
  137.  
  138.   Stéphane Bunel : Katov
  139.                    TinyStartup is now really good and reliable. no more 'c.o'.
  140.                    'Amiga for ever and PC for Lamer...'
  141.  
  142.   Christophe Paoutoff : Showgger
  143.                         Hello 'Chojé', GSC is the best CPU board ever made.
  144.                         4 CPUs, 3 CoPros and NO hardware needed :-)
  145.                         That's the Exec's fault !!!!
  146.  
  147.   Olivier Laudren : Cople
  148.                     RayTracing master !!! How are you my friend ?
  149.  
  150.   Nicolas Frank : Gryzor
  151.                   ProWizard et DeliWizard are the ProTracker rulers !!!
  152.  
  153.   Kersten Emmrich : Emmy
  154.                     33MHz ist nein genug, 40MHz ist gut !!!
  155.   
  156.   Magnus Holmgren :
  157.                     Hello to my friend, the swedish knight :)
  158.  
  159.   Federico Giannici :
  160.                       impossible to live without CycleToMenu !!!
  161.  
  162.   and many others I forgot, sorry :(
  163.  
  164.  
  165.   8 - Contacting the author :
  166.   ---------------------------
  167.  
  168.   I can be reached at :
  169.  
  170.     Goncalves A. Georges
  171.     27, rue Morand
  172.     75011 Paris
  173.     FRANCE
  174.  
  175.   Sorry, no E-Mail address ( not yet :) .
  176.  
  177.  
  178.  
  179.  
  180.